# 3D Page Scroll
A webpage (or long content) presented as a tilted 3D card. Spring-eased scroll reveals specific sections while the static 3D perspective adds physical depth.
## How It Works
Two independent transforms combine:
1. **3D tilt** — Static `rotateY` + `rotateX` with `perspective` on the card. The angle does **not** change during the scene.
2. **Scroll** — The content inside the card translates vertically (`translateY` / `y` in GSAP) within a clipped container, driven by a GSAP tween. Spring-like deceleration via `ease: "power3.out"` or `"power4.out"`.
Optional layer:
3. **Spotlight overlay** — A radial-gradient mask dims everything except a focal region after the scroll lands. Use to draw attention to one section.
For multi-step scrolling (scroll → pause → scroll), use multiple `tl.to(".page-content", { y: -<distance>, ... }, <position>)` calls at different timeline positions.
## HTML
```html
<div
class="scene"
id="page-scroll-scene"
data-composition-id="page-scroll-scene"
data-start="0"
data-duration="5"
data-track-index="0"
>
<div class="tilt-card">
<div class="page-content">
<!-- Full {Brand} webpage recreation, taller than card height so
scrolling matters. Each section is real DOM, not a screenshot. -->
<section class="page-hero">{heroContents}</section>
<section class="page-features">{featuresContents}</section>
<section class="page-target" id="target-section">{targetContents}</section>
<section class="page-cta">{ctaContents}</section>
</div>
<div class="spotlight"></div>
</div>
</div>
```
## CSS (hero-frame layout)
```css
.scene {
position: relative;
width: 100%;
height: 100%;
}
.tilt-card {
position: absolute;
left: 50%;
top: 50%;
/* tilt + perspective set in CSS only if no other transform tween touches
this element. If GSAP also tweens scale on .tilt-card, set the tilt
via gsap.set() to avoid matrix overwrites. */
transform: translate(-50%, -50%) perspective({perspectivePx}) rotateY({tiltYDeg}) rotateX({tiltXDeg});
transform-style: preserve-3d;
width: {cardWidth};
height: {cardHeight};
border-radius: 24px;
background: {cardBackgroundColor};
overflow: hidden; /* clip the scrolling content */
/* shadow X-offset sign must match tiltY sign (negative tiltY ⇒ positive X) */
box-shadow: 40px 30px 80px r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.45);
}
.page-content {
position: absolute;
top: 0;
left: 0;
width: 100%;
/* height is intrinsic from sections — taller than .tilt-card.height */
}
.page-content section {
height: {sectionHeight}; /* sections sized so cumulative offset = target distance */
padding: 64px;
/* section-specific styling … */
}
.spotlight {
position: absolute;
inset: 0;
pointer-events: none;
opacity: 0;
background: radial-gradient(
ellipse 60% 35% at 50% 50%,
transparent 50%,
{spotlightDimColor} 100%
);
}
```
## GSAP Timeline
```html
<script src="https://cdn.jsdelivr.net/npm/gsap@3.14.2/dist/gsap.min.js"></script>
<script>
window.__timelines = window.__timelines || {};
const tl = gsap.timeline({ paused: true });
// Phase 1 — Card enters (optional, can skip if card is in from t=0)
// Phase 2 — Scroll to the target section.
// SCROLL_DISTANCE is measured at design time from the page layout
// (top of .page-content origin to vertical center of #target-section,
// accounting for card height).
tl.to(
".page-content",
{
y: -SCROLL_DISTANCE,
duration: SCROLL_DUR,
ease: "power3.out",
},
SCROLL_AT,
);
// Phase 3 — Spotlight fades in on the target after scroll settles
tl.to(
".spotlight",
{
opacity: 1,
duration: SPOTLIGHT_FADE_DUR,
ease: "power1.inOut",
},
SPOTLIGHT_AT,
);
window.__timelines["page-scroll-scene"] = tl;
</script>
```
### Multi-phase scroll variant
```js
// Scroll to section A → hold → scroll to section B.
// SCROLL_DISTANCE_A and SCROLL_DISTANCE_B are both measured from the
// .page-content origin (NOT delta from previous step).
tl.to(
".page-content",
{ y: -SCROLL_DISTANCE_A, duration: SCROLL_DUR, ease: "power3.out" },
SCROLL_AT_A,
);
tl.to(
".page-content",
{ y: -SCROLL_DISTANCE_B, duration: SCROLL_DUR, ease: "power3.out" },
SCROLL_AT_B,
);
```
GSAP composes successive `y:` tweens additively when targeting the same property — each tween starts from the value left by the previous tween.
## How to Choose Values
- **tiltYDeg** — static Y rotation in CSS (or via `gsap.set()`).
- Range: -12 to -4 (left-leaning) or 4 to 12 (right-leaning); 0 = no perspective rotation.
- Effects: bigger magnitude = more dramatic 3D; near 0 collapses to a flat panel.
- Constraints: shadow X-offset sign must match (negative tiltY ⇒ positive box-shadow X).
- **tiltXDeg** — static X rotation.
- Range: 0-6
- Effects: positive tilts the top edge away from the viewer.
- **perspectivePx** — perspective distance.
- Range: 800-2000 px
- Effects: smaller = more dramatic foreshortening; larger = nearly orthographic.
- **cardWidth / cardHeight** — card frame size.
- Constraints: card height < total content height, otherwise scroll has nothing to reveal.
- **sectionHeight** — height of each scrolled section.
- Constraints: sum of all section heights ≥ cardHeight + SCROLL_DISTANCE so the target section ends up within frame after scroll.
- **SCROLL_AT** — timeline second at which the scroll tween begins.
- Constraints: must be ≥ end of any prior fade-in tweens on `.page-content`.
- **SCROLL_DUR** — duration of one scroll tween.
- Range: 0.8-1.8 s
- Effects: shorter feels like a hard cut; longer feels programmatic.
- **SCROLL_DISTANCE** — pixels to translate `.page-content` upward.
- Constraints: measured once at design time from the target section's offset; NOT a free tunable.
- **SPOTLIGHT_AT** — timeline second at which the spotlight begins fading in.
- Constraints: should be ≥ SCROLL_AT + SCROLL_DUR (or slightly earlier for overlapping handoff) so the spotlight reveals the freshly-arrived section.
- **SPOTLIGHT_FADE_DUR** — spotlight opacity fade-in duration.
- Range: 0.4-0.8 s
- Multi-phase variant — **SCROLL_AT_A / SCROLL_AT_B**: must satisfy `SCROLL_AT_A + SCROLL_DUR ≤ SCROLL_AT_B` so the two scrolls don't fight for the y property.
Ease family — discrete choice:
- `power3.out` — heavy deceleration; reads as a programmatic scroll that "lands". Default.
- `power4.out` — even heavier; reads as a momentum-driven scroll.
- `power2.inOut` — symmetric; reads as a cinematic camera pan rather than UI scroll.
Pick one and use it across all scrolls in the scene — mixing easings within one scene reads as jerky.
## Key Principles
- **Tilt is static**, not animated. The card holds its angle the whole scene.
- **Shadow direction matches tilt**: a left-leaning card casts shadow to the right (positive X shadow offset). Mismatch breaks the 3D illusion.
- **Page content is real HTML**, not a screenshot. Screenshots can't be individually highlighted or scrolled-to with precision.
- **Use real layout for distances**: scroll target distance comes from the actual cumulative section heights, not estimated pixel values.
- **Spotlight as overlay**, not inside the page-content — overlay sits above scrolling content and stays fixed relative to the card.
## Critical Constraints
- **`overflow: hidden` on `.tilt-card`** — scrolling content must clip at card boundaries, otherwise it leaks past the rounded corners
- **`transform-style: preserve-3d`** on `.tilt-card` — required for any 3D children (or for combining `perspective` with rotations cleanly)
- **Timeline must be paused**: `gsap.timeline({ paused: true })`. Never `tl.play()` — HF seeks frame-by-frame
- **Registry key = `data-composition-id`**: `window.__timelines["page-scroll-scene"]` must match scene root's `data-composition-id`
- **Finite scroll distance** — compute from actual content geometry; don't use arbitrary values that may overshoot the content end
- **Same easing across multi-phase scroll** — mixing `power3.out` and `power1.inOut` looks jerky; pick one for the scene
